We are very excited to have the following P-51's attending "Mustang Mania",

The Commemorative Air Force's P-51C Mustang "TUSKEGEE Airmen"
Vlado Lenoch's P-51D Mustang "Moonbeam McSwine"
The Tri-State Warbird Museum's P-51D Mustang "Cincinnati Miss"
Mike George's P-51D Mustang "Worry Bird"
Doug Matthews P-51D Mustang "The Rebel"
The Warbird Heritage Foundation's P-51D Mustang "Baby-Duck"
Tom Patten's P-51D Mustang "Sweetie Face"
Tony Buechler's P-51D Mustang "Petie 2nd"
Mark and Dave Murphy / Russell Cecil's P-51D Mustang "NEVER Miss"
Wes Stowers and Billy Strickland's P-51D Mustang "Ain't Misbehavin'"
The Commemorative Air Force's P-51D Mustang "Red Nose"
Tom Duffy's P-51D Mustang "KWITCHERBITCHIN"
The Cavanaugh Flight Museum's P-51D Mustang "The Brat III"
The Commemorative Air Force's P-51D Mustang "GUNFIGHTER"
Mike Henningsen's P-51D Mustang "Big Beautiful Doll"
